Transaction 86e52d1fa55fad849fa7b659a87e139a90944a4055ce4fb01b198da83de2230f

1 Input
1 Outputs
  • 86e52d1fa55fad849fa7b659a87e139a90944a4055ce4fb01b198da83de2230f:0
  • value  3199427
    address  1HUbjXMBMcAYQpYtYNKZbMQytDLkSbKvHK